Solving for in this equation 7p+2t=n
Because 2t does not contain the variable to solve for, move it to the right-hand side of the equation by subtracting 2t from both sides.
7p=−2t+n
Divide each term in the equation by 7.
7p/7=−2t/7+n/7
Simplify
p=−2t/7+n/7
p=−2t/7+n/7 is the answer
